Transaction 3fc38b94abf9a3d7c6b73e23ca468a523d51a6a95537b7660617ba59b2522390

2 Input
2 Outputs
  • 3fc38b94abf9a3d7c6b73e23ca468a523d51a6a95537b7660617ba59b2522390:0
  • value  11407
    address  2MwELNUz5r2hbX4MWS3wCndBvtsPne6LXqb
  • 3fc38b94abf9a3d7c6b73e23ca468a523d51a6a95537b7660617ba59b2522390:1
  • value  140721
    address  mu1oX5L2b5XEvmnyYB4UH8KyFtWeTDykby